test "HashMap exact resize threshold trigger" {
// Start with capacity 8
var map = try HashMap([]const u8, i32).init(std.testing.allocator, 8);
defer map.deinit();

try std.testing.expectEqual(@as(usize, 8), map.entries.len);

var keys = try std.ArrayList([]const u8).initCapacity(std.testing.allocator, 10);
defer {
for (keys.items) |key| {
std.testing.allocator.free(key);
}
keys.deinit();
}

// Insert items up to load factor threshold.
// For capacity 8, threshold is 8 * 3 / 4 = 6.
// Insert 6 items, count becomes 6.
var i: i32 = 0;
while (i < 6) : (i += 1) {
const key = try std.fmt.allocPrint(std.testing.allocator, "thresh_{d}", .{i});
try keys.append(key);
try map.put(key, i);
}

// Array should not have resized yet
try std.testing.expectEqual(@as(usize, 8), map.entries.len);
try std.testing.expectEqual(@as(usize, 6), map.count);

// Inserting 7th item when count is 6 should trigger resize
// because count (6) >= capacity (8) * 3 / 4 (6)
const trigger_key = try std.fmt.allocPrint(std.testing.allocator, "thresh_6", .{});
try keys.append(trigger_key);
try map.put(trigger_key, 6);

// Verify it resized to 16
try std.testing.expectEqual(@as(usize, 16), map.entries.len);
try std.testing.expectEqual(@as(usize, 7), map.count);

// Verify all items are intact after resize
i = 0;
while (i <= 6) : (i += 1) {
const key = keys.items[@as(usize, @intCast(i))];
const val = map.get(key);
try std.testing.expect(val != null);
try std.testing.expectEqual(i, val.?.*);
}
}
